Currently we can not tell WHY people unsubscribe. There is no report to generate about the why. MaillChimp had that feature.
Feature request is to add a drop down with reasons unbsubscribers can pick from as soon as they hit the unsubscribe link from the email's footer. There should be no reason why they need to hit a custom link to go to a different page to explain why they unsubscribed.

Because of the changes with Google and Yahoo this year and the requirement for one-click unsubscribes, perhaps this enhancement request would be best placed along with the unsubscribe confirmation. In order to optimize submissions, a single-select or multi-select checkbox field would be ideal. It would be helpfull as well to have controll over the confirmation message upon submission of the unsubscribe reason.
